Missing Holiday 14-Year-Old Has Been Located Safe

PASCO COUNTY, Fla. – Dayonna Harris has been located and is safe, according to the Pasco Sheriff’s Office.

ORIGINAL REPORT: The Pasco Sheriff’s Office has issued a public appeal for help locating a 14-year-old girl who has been reported missing. Dayonna Harris was last seen on the morning of March 17, around 8:00 a.m., in the Salisbury Drive area of Holiday.

Investigators currently classify her as a missing runaway and are asking anyone with information regarding her current location to come forward.

Harris is 5 feet 2 inches tall and weighs approximately 115 pounds. She has brown eyes and black and blonde hair. When she was last spotted on Tuesday morning, she was wearing a red hoodie with white lettering, a pair of jeans, and was carrying a pink backpack.
